Beef Curry
How to Make It
Heat some oil in a saucepan over a medium heat. Add the onion and cook for 3 minutes until they start to soften. Add the ginger and cook for 30 secs. Transfer to a bowl.
If needed add some more oil into the same pan and cook the beef for 2-3 minutes or until browned. Return the onion mixture to the pan. Add curry powder and stir to coat.
Add the coconut milk, cover and cook for 30 minutes.
Add the mushrooms and cauliflower and cook for a further 20 minutes or until the beef is tender.
Ingredients
- Splash of virgin olive oil
- 1 diced steak
- 1/2 red onion peeled and chopped
- 1/2 piece of ginger peeled and finely sliced
- 1 tsp of curry powder (adjust to taste)
- 1/2 tin of coconut milk
- 60g button mushrooms halved
- 60g florets of cauliflower halved
